WebAn eyeglass prescription is made for lenses that will be positioned outside of your eyes. A contact lens prescription is designed for lenses that will fit directly on the surface of your eye. The wrong prescription could lead to an uncomfortable fit and potential eye damage. WebWhat Are Contact Lenses? Contact lenses are designed to cover the cornea, the clear covering of the eye. They stay in place by adhering to the tear film of the eye, and through the pressure from the eyelids. When you blink, your eyelid glides over the contact lens, enabling a cleansing and lubricating action to keep the contact lens comfortable ...
